Sample Answer
I'd love to talk about my close friend, Sarah, who recently achieved a significant milestone in her career. Sarah has always been ambitious and dedicated, and her success comes in the form of being promoted to a senior manager at a prestigious marketing firm. This promotion was a hard-earned accolade, reflecting her years of effort, her creativity, and her ability to lead a team successfully.
When she received the news of her promotion, Sarah decided to celebrate in a rather unique way. She hosted a small gathering at her home, inviting our close friends and family to join the celebration. The evening was filled with laughter, heartfelt speeches, and a delicious spread of food. It was inspiring to hear her share her journey and the obstacles she faced along the way, which made her success even more meaningful for all of us.
I felt an immense sense of pride for Sarah because I witnessed the countless hours she devoted to her work, even when times were tough. Her determination and resilience not only paid off but also set a fantastic example for others. It reminded me that hard work truly does result in success, and being able to celebrate that journey with her made it all the more special.
